CM18 7NB is a small residential cluster nestled within the Harlow District Council area of Essex. With a population of 1,629, it is a compact community positioned near Harlow Town, a hub of local services and transport links. The area was redefined in 2024 as part of a boundary review, merging parts of previous wards to form the Sumners and Kingsmoor electoral district. Residents of CM18 7NB have access to several educational institutions, including Maunds Wood Primary School, a primary school serving younger children. Stewards School – Science Specialist, Harlow, is another primary school, while Stewards Academy – Science Specialist, Harlow, is an academy with an Ofsted rating of satisfactory. The Education & Youth Services Ltd (Harlow) is a special school catering to specific educational needs. The community in CM18 7NB has a median age of 47, with the majority of residents falling within the 30-64 age range. This suggests a mature population, likely with established careers and family structures. Home ownership rates stand at 41%, indicating a mix of owner-occupied properties and rental homes. The predominant accommodation type is houses, which may reflect a preference for standalone living spaces over flats. The predominant ethnic group is White, aligning with broader trends in the region.
